The hexadecimal color code #ACF94A corresponds to the code RGB( 172, 249, 74 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,67 level), green (at 0,98 level) and blue (at 0,29 level). Its brightness is 63% and its saturation is 93%. It is composed of red at 34%, green at 50% and blue at 14%.

Uses of #ACF94A in CSS

When using #ACF94A as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#ACF94A as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
